Benson Stone asked:
<<Should w celebrate American holidays?>>

The answer could perhaps be found in Jeremiah 29: 7 " And seek the peace
of the city that I have exiled you there and pray for her to G-d,
because thru their peace will you have peace."

I would suggest that <<seek the peace>> would include celebrating the
various holidays of the country and the concepts they stand for--July 4th
for independence, Thanksgiving to give thanx etc.

Needless to say we should abstain from frivoloty, drunkedness and those
holidays that emanate from other religions (like Christmas which is also a
national holiday).
